Asbestos-related diseases

Exposure to asbestos can lead to a wide range of ailments. The mesothelioma disease is the most severe. Mesothelioma has led to the deaths of many people. Other asbestos-related illnesses include lung cancer, asbestosis, pleural plaques and the pleural effusion.

Mesothelioma is a rare but fatal condition, is caused by asbestos lawyer fibers that accumulate in the lungs. They then cause irritation to the linings of the ribcage (the Pleura) as well as the chest cavity and abdominal cavity. Inhaling these fibers can lead to scarring in the lungs. This is called asbestosis. It can also lead to thickened patches of pleura (pleural plaques) or a more extensive fibrosis. Pleural plaques and diffused fibrosis reduce lung capacity, as measured by breathing tests. They can also cause discomfort and breathing difficulties but they don't lead to cancer or mesothelioma.

Symptoms of asbestos-related disease often do not manifest until decades after exposure. This is because it can take between 20 to 50 years for inhalation of asbestos fibers to damage the lungs. A number of states have established special asbestos courts in which claims can be filed and resolved more efficiently. Judges have also created special procedures to review and resolve such cases.

New York is one such state with its own asbestos court known as NYCAL. The number of cases in this court has grown steadily, as more and more asbestos victims seek compensation from solvent former asbestos defendants who have gone bankrupt. The New York Supreme Court created a special judicial board to supervise NYCAL in order to prevent the justice system from becoming overwhelmed.

A panel of six Supreme Court judges will review each case in NYCAL to determine whether or not to take it up with it. Judges will also consider the merits of each claim to determine the amount the plaintiff is entitled to.
